82static int calculate_threshold(struct zone *zone)
83{
84	int threshold;
85	int mem;	/* memory in 128 MB units */
86
87	/*
88	 * The threshold scales with the number of processors and the amount
89	 * of memory per zone. More memory means that we can defer updates for
90	 * longer, more processors could lead to more contention.
91 	 * fls() is used to have a cheap way of logarithmic scaling.
92	 *
93	 * Some sample thresholds:
94	 *
95	 * Threshold	Processors	(fls)	Zonesize	fls(mem+1)
96	 * ------------------------------------------------------------------
97	 * 8		1		1	0.9-1 GB	4
98	 * 16		2		2	0.9-1 GB	4
99	 * 20 		2		2	1-2 GB		5
100	 * 24		2		2	2-4 GB		6
101	 * 28		2		2	4-8 GB		7
102	 * 32		2		2	8-16 GB		8
103	 * 4		2		2	<128M		1
104	 * 30		4		3	2-4 GB		5
105	 * 48		4		3	8-16 GB		8
106	 * 32		8		4	1-2 GB		4
107	 * 32		8		4	0.9-1GB		4
108	 * 10		16		5	<128M		1
109	 * 40		16		5	900M		4
110	 * 70		64		7	2-4 GB		5
111	 * 84		64		7	4-8 GB		6
112	 * 108		512		9	4-8 GB		6
113	 * 125		1024		10	8-16 GB		8
114	 * 125		1024		10	16-32 GB	9
115	 */
116
117	mem = zone->present_pages >> (27 - PAGE_SHIFT);
118
119	threshold = 2 * fls(num_online_cpus()) * (1 + fls(mem));
120
121	/*
122	 * Maximum threshold is 125
123	 */
124	threshold = min(125, threshold);
125
126	return threshold;
127}

180/*
181 * Optimized increment and decrement functions.
182 *
183 * These are only for a single page and therefore can take a struct page *
184 * argument instead of struct zone *. This allows the inclusion of the code
185 * generated for page_zone(page) into the optimized functions.
186 *
187 * No overflow check is necessary and therefore the differential can be
188 * incremented or decremented in place which may allow the compilers to
189 * generate better code.
190 * The increment or decrement is known and therefore one boundary check can
191 * be omitted.
192 *
193 * NOTE: These functions are very performance sensitive. Change only
194 * with care.
195 *
196 * Some processors have inc/dec instructions that are atomic vs an interrupt.
197 * However, the code must first determine the differential location in a zone
198 * based on the processor number and then inc/dec the counter. There is no
199 * guarantee without disabling preemption that the processor will not change
200 * in between and therefore the atomicity vs. interrupt cannot be exploited
201 * in a useful way here.
202 */
203void __inc_zone_state(struct zone *zone, enum zone_stat_item item)
204{
205	struct per_cpu_pageset *pcp = zone_pcp(zone, smp_processor_id());
206	s8 *p = pcp->vm_stat_diff + item;
207
208	(*p)++;
209
210	if (unlikely(*p > pcp->stat_threshold)) {
211		int overstep = pcp->stat_threshold / 2;
212
213		zone_page_state_add(*p + overstep, zone, item);
214		*p = -overstep;
215	}
216}

276/*
277 * Update the zone counters for one cpu.
278 *
279 * The cpu specified must be either the current cpu or a processor that
280 * is not online. If it is the current cpu then the execution thread must
281 * be pinned to the current cpu.
282 *
283 * Note that refresh_cpu_vm_stats strives to only access
284 * node local memory. The per cpu pagesets on remote zones are placed
285 * in the memory local to the processor using that pageset. So the
286 * loop over all zones will access a series of cachelines local to
287 * the processor.
288 *
289 * The call to zone_page_state_add updates the cachelines with the
290 * statistics in the remote zone struct as well as the global cachelines
291 * with the global counters. These could cause remote node cache line
292 * bouncing and will have to be only done when necessary.
293 */
294void refresh_cpu_vm_stats(int cpu)
295{
296	struct zone *zone;
297	int i;
298	int global_diff[NR_VM_ZONE_STAT_ITEMS] = { 0, };
299
300	for_each_populated_zone(zone) {
301		struct per_cpu_pageset *p;
302
303		p = zone_pcp(zone, cpu);
304
305		for (i = 0; i < NR_VM_ZONE_STAT_ITEMS; i++)
306			if (p->vm_stat_diff[i]) {
307				unsigned long flags;
308				int v;
309
310				local_irq_save(flags);
311				v = p->vm_stat_diff[i];
312				p->vm_stat_diff[i] = 0;
313				local_irq_restore(flags);
314				atomic_long_add(v, &zone->vm_stat[i]);
315				global_diff[i] += v;
316#ifdef CONFIG_NUMA
317				/* 3 seconds idle till flush */
318				p->expire = 3;
319#endif
320			}
321		cond_resched();
322#ifdef CONFIG_NUMA
323		/*
324		 * Deal with draining the remote pageset of this
325		 * processor
326		 *
327		 * Check if there are pages remaining in this pageset
328		 * if not then there is nothing to expire.
329		 */
330		if (!p->expire || !p->pcp.count)
331			continue;
332
333		/*
334		 * We never drain zones local to this processor.
335		 */
336		if (zone_to_nid(zone) == numa_node_id()) {
337			p->expire = 0;
338			continue;
339		}
340
341		p->expire--;
342		if (p->expire)
343			continue;
344
345		if (p->pcp.count)
346			drain_zone_pages(zone, &p->pcp);
347#endif
348	}
349
350	for (i = 0; i < NR_VM_ZONE_STAT_ITEMS; i++)
351		if (global_diff[i])
352			atomic_long_add(global_diff[i], &vm_stat[i]);
353}
